Former NSW premier Nathan Rees has reportedly been assaulted by a woman at a western Sydney shopping centre.

Police have confirmed they are investigating an attack by a woman on a 46-year-old man at Seven Hills shops on Wednesday afternoon.

He did not require medical treatment.

Mr Rees was dumped as premier for Kristina Keneally in 2010.

He will retire from public office after 17 years at the March state election.
